Christmas Markets
Nearby towns like Aigle, Montreux, and Lausanne have large Christmas markets featuring handcrafted goods, festive food, and decorations. It’s a great way to discover Swiss culture, try fantastic food, and get excited about the holidays! Montreux market is one of Switzerland's most famous Christmas markets, with over 150 stalls, a lakeside view, and activities like Santa's Flying Sleigh.

Tobogganing Park
The Leysin Tobogganing Park transforms into a winter wonderland in the festive season, offering exciting snow tubing tracks. It’s a great way to spend a few hours, but be warned, it's not for the faint of heart! This exhilarating activity gets your heart racing, and is a favorite amongst our students!

Ice Skating
The Leysin Sports Center features an ice rink perfect for an afternoon of fun! Whether you’re a beginner or an experienced skater, this rink is great for hanging out with friends. In the Sports Center, you can also try curling, a winter sport that involves sliding stones on ice towards a target.

Rochers-de-Naye Santa Claus Village
Close to Montreux is Rochers-de-Naye Santa Claus Village. This magical place can be accessed via the cog railway departing from Montreux, which takes visitors up the mountain to Rochers-de-Naye at an altitude of 2,042 m. The cog ride up the mountain offers panoramic views of the Alps, which in itself makes the journey worth it! Here, visitors can meet Santa Claus, explore his grotto, and enjoy the festive atmosphere high above the clouds.
